$609K Pot Won On Full Tilt Poker … With Ducks!

To say its been just a bit crazy of a week over the high-limit tables at Full Tilt Poker would be a minor understatement.

I mean first off, three of the biggest pots in history were played on the site just a few days ago, all of them ranging from about $475k to the largest hitting at exactly $499,037!  Unfortunately for Tom “durrr” Dwan, he lost two of those, each to Full Tilt Red Pro Peter Jepsen.  Jepsen’s huge scores from that session were incredible, and more importantly he was now the holder of one of the most esteemed records in poker.

Well….that was until Friday afternoon.

Playing at famed F.T.P. high stakes poker table RailHeaven - which is where the aforementioned record pots had taken place at just days before - two of the biggest action junkies around the world got set to bash heads in what would be one of the sickest online poker pots ever recorded in history.  Trex313 aka Hac Hang (who had $297k+ behind) and Patatino (rumored to be uber-billionaire Guy Laliberte, had $307k behind) were involved in some deep-stacked action with fellow pro Phil “OMGClayAiken” Galfond (stack unknown at the time of the hand) on a flop of  T - 6 - 8 (2 diamonds).

Now after Galfond had fired out the first barrel, Patatino quickly raised the action to $35k total.  In position, Trex313 then re-raised to $88k!  OMG decided to just GTFO after it was clear that Trex and Patatino were the only ones with invites to this pot. When the decision was put back on Patatino after Galfond’d fold - it was pretty clear what his next move was going to be:  ALL-IN.

As everyone expected, Trex made the insane call with a straight flush draw - Jd 9d.  Patatino turned over an even crazier drawing hand - Qd 2d.  So with their draws and other live cards, both of these guys were basically racing for a total pot that had now been built up to a NEW online record-shattering $609,730!

The turn hit a 2 of hearts, pairing one of Patatino’s hole cards, and leaving Dac Hang hoping and praying for a river card that would steal away this enormous pot from his rival.

However, his hopes and prayers went unanswered as a 4 of clubs hit on 5th street, giving Patatino the new online world record for the biggest pot ever won!
